2016 Hymer Van MOT Analysis

The 2016 Hymer Van has an MOT pass rate of 92.9% based on 70 tests — well above the UK average for UK vehicles. Cars of this vintage present for MOT with an average of 20,400 miles on the odometer. With a 7.1% failure rate, the 2016 Van is rated as "Excellent" for MOT reliability.

The leading cause of MOT failure for the 2016 Hymer Van is Visibility, responsible for 1.4% of failures. Visibility failures relate to the windscreen, wipers, washers, mirrors, and view-obstructing damage. Cracks in the windscreen swept area, ineffective wipers, or empty washer bottles are common causes. Typical repair costs range from £10–300. Body, chassis, structure is the second most common issue at 1.4%.

Body, chassis, structure — 1.4% of failures

Body, chassis, structure issues account for 1.4% of MOT failures on 2016 Hymer Van models. Body and structure failures include excessive corrosion, sharp edges, loose panels, and damage to the vehicle frame. Rust is the primary concern, especially on older vehicles or those exposed to road salt. Typical repair costs: £100–500+. Pre-MOT check: Inspect sills, wheel arches, door bottoms, and the chassis for rust. Surface rust is acceptable but structural corrosion or holes will fail. Check that all doors, bonnet, and boot close securely.
